Handover — Vexler partner SFTP drop

Ownership moves to you today. Drop runs hourly from Vexler's end into the intake bucket via the relay host. Watch for zero-byte files; their exporter flakes on Mondays. Creds live in the ops vault, path noted in the runbook. Vault auto-seals after 48h idle. Support escalations go to the on-call rotation, not me. If the vault is sealed when you need it, unseal with the recovery passphrase below.

recovery phrase for tadug-fafof: zorwyn-kasion

Alert: sqlfence lint failure on merge queue. A SQL file in the Bramleigh repo violated rules (likely missing explicit column lists or an unqualified DELETE). Blocking by design; do not bypass. Reviewer: check the offending migration before re-queueing. Rule definitions and suppression policy are documented on the internal page below.

dashboard of yafog-fajof = https://jira.tolvaqsys.internal/pages/pages/projects/49fe21c4

Runbook fragment: account recovery — PayStria export change

Context for review: the payroll export moved from fixed-width to the new column-delimited format in release 3.2, and the migration service account got locked mid-cutover. Recovery path: restore the service account, re-run the export converter, diff against last known-good output. Do not merge the format PR until the account is live. To restore the locked service account, enter the recovery passphrase below.

unlock words, yawig-kagef: gordor-holvan-ulaael-pramir-ulaiel-tamdor

Changelog 4.8.0 — Telemetry compression defaults changed. Starting with this release, Pondermetrics agents compress telemetry payloads with zstd by default instead of sending them uncompressed. Customers on constrained links should see roughly 60% less egress; CPU overhead is negligible. If a customer reports ingest errors after upgrading, verify their collector accepts compressed bodies. The new default settings are listed below.

service settings:
[casax]
port = 6379
team = rusir
host = casax.zemvarhq.corp
region = outer-4
access_code = ac_9808ce
timeout_ms = 1500